《云计算与网络的紧密关联:否定云计算非网络化的观点》
云计算是一种基于互联网的计算方式,通过这种方式,共享的软硬件资源和信息可以按需提供给计算机和其他设备,云计算的特点中绝不可能有“非网络化”这一属性,网络是云计算的核心支撑,没有高效的网络,云计算就什么都不是。
一、云计算的资源共享依赖网络
云计算的一个重要特性是资源共享,在云环境中,多个用户能够共享计算资源、存储资源、软件资源等,这些资源分布在不同的数据中心,通过网络连接在一起,云服务提供商可能在全球各地建立数据中心,里面存放着海量的服务器和存储设备,当用户请求使用云计算资源时,无论是启动一个虚拟机,还是存储一份数据,都是通过网络将用户的指令发送到数据中心,然后数据中心根据指令调配资源,并将结果通过网络反馈给用户,如果没有网络,不同地域的数据中心就无法与用户建立联系,资源共享也就无从谈起,企业用户无法获取云端的软件来进行办公,个人用户也不能使用云盘存储自己的照片和文件等。
图片来源于网络,如有侵权联系删除
二、云计算的可扩展性基于网络
可扩展性是云计算的又一显著特点,企业的业务需求是不断变化的,云计算能够根据需求灵活地扩展或收缩资源,一家电商企业在促销活动期间,网站的流量会急剧增加,需要更多的计算资源来保证网站的正常运行,云计算平台可以通过网络迅速调配额外的服务器资源来应对高峰流量,这种可扩展性是通过网络对众多计算资源进行动态管理来实现的,网络就像是一个无形的桥梁,将分散的计算资源整合起来,根据需求进行灵活组合,没有网络,数据中心无法感知用户的资源需求变化,也就无法实现这种动态的资源扩展和收缩,企业可能会因为资源不足而导致业务中断,或者因为过度配置资源而造成浪费。
三、云计算的服务交付离不开网络
图片来源于网络,如有侵权联系删除
云计算以多种服务模式存在,如软件即服务(SaaS)、平台即服务(PaaS)和基础设施即服务(IaaS),在SaaS模式下,用户通过网络浏览器直接使用云服务提供商提供的软件,像我们日常使用的在线办公软件等,PaaS模式下,开发者利用云平台提供的开发环境进行软件的开发和部署,这一过程中代码的上传、测试环境的搭建以及应用的发布都需要网络连接,对于IaaS模式,用户租用云服务提供商的基础设施资源,如服务器、存储等,对这些资源的操作和管理都是通过网络进行的,如果没有网络,这些服务模式都无法正常工作,用户将无法获取软件服务,开发者不能进行开发,企业也不能租用基础设施资源。
四、云计算的分布式计算依靠网络
云计算常常采用分布式计算技术,将任务分解并分配到多个计算节点上进行并行处理,以提高计算效率,这些计算节点可能位于不同的数据中心,甚至不同的地理位置,网络负责将任务分配到各个节点,并且收集各个节点的计算结果进行汇总,在大数据分析场景中,需要处理海量的数据,云计算平台会将数据分割后发送到不同的计算节点进行分析,最后通过网络将各个节点的分析结果整合起来,没有网络的连接,分布式计算就无法协调各个节点的工作,整个计算任务就会陷入瘫痪。
图片来源于网络,如有侵权联系删除
网络是云计算的命脉,云计算的每一个特点都与网络紧密相连,否定云计算网络化的特点是完全错误的,高效的网络保障了云计算的正常运行、资源调配、服务交付等各个方面,是云计算不可或缺的基础。
评论列表